cs6303 model question paper 3

Upload: navis-nayagam

Post on 07-Jul-2018

214 views

Category:

Documents


0 download

TRANSCRIPT

  • 8/18/2019 CS6303 Model Question Paper 3

    1/1

    MARTHANDAM COLLEGE OF ENGINEERING AND

    TECHNOLOGYMODEL EXAM III - 2016

    Semester VI

    ELECTRONICS & COMMUNICATION ENGINEERING

    CS60! COM"UTER ARCHITECTURE

    T#me$ 3 Hrs M%#m'm M%r(s $ 100

      St%))$ D. Navis Nayagam ************************************************* 

    "%rt ! A +102,20

    A.s/er A 'est#.s

    1. List any four of the eight great ideas invented by

    computer architects.

    2. Distinguish Pipelining from Parallelism.3. How overflow occur in subtraction .

    !. "hat do you mean by sub#word parallelism$. "hat are %#&ype instructions

    '. "hat is a branch prediction buffet(). Differentiate between *trong scaling and "ea+ scaling.,. -ompare /0 and N/0 multiprocessors.

    . "hat is the need to implement memory as ahierarchy

    1. Point out how D/0 can improve 45 speed.

    "%rt ! 3 +4 X 16 , 50

    11. 6a7 Discuss about the8 various techni9ues torepresent instructions in a computer system 61'7

    5r 

    6b7"hat is the need for addressing in a computer system :;plain the different addressing modes with

    suitable e;amples. 61'7 

    12. 6a7:;plain the se9uential version of  

    multiplication algorithm and its hardware. 61'7

    5r 

    6b7 i7 :;plain how floating point addition is carried out

    in a computer system.  ii7 :-&5% systems. 61'7

    5r 8 (

    6b7 "hat is Hardware multithreading -ompare and

    contrast ?ine grained /ulti#&hreading and -oarse

    grained /ulti#&hreading8 61'7

    1$. 6a7 6i7 :;plain mapping functions in cache memory to

    determine how memory bloc+s are placed in -ache.

    6ii7 :;plain in detail about the @us 0rbitration techni9ues in

    D/0. 6,7 61'75r 

    6b7 "hat is virtual memory :;plain the stepsinvolved( in virtual memory address translation8 61'7.